University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center is a small public college stongly focused on medical majors and located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. This school was founded in 1971 and is presently offering bachelor's, certificates, master's, and doctoral degrees in 17 medical programs.

University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center is rather expensive: depending on the program, tuition varies around $27,000 a year. If you seek a cheaper alternative, check Affordable Colleges in Oklahoma listing.

According to recent analysis, University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center area is relatively dangerous; the school is reported to have a poor rating for campus safety.

Based on 67 evaluation criteria, University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center medical program ranks #238 Medical School (out of 2817; top 10%) in the United States and The Third Best Medical School in Oklahoma.
